Metal plating and finishing involve applying a metal coating or surface treatment to a base material to improve characteristics such as corrosion resistance, wear resistance, conductivity, and aesthetic appeal. Common metal finishing techniques include electroplating, electroless plating, anodizing, powder coating, galvanizing, and polishing. These processes are applied to a variety of metals including steel, aluminum, copper, nickel, and zinc.

Key Market Drivers

  • Automotive Industry Expansion
    The automotive sector is one of the largest consumers of metal plating and finishing services. Components such as engine parts, transmission systems, chassis, and decorative trims require durable coatings to withstand extreme temperatures, friction, and exposure to chemicals. With the rise in electric vehicle (EV) production and lightweight materials, manufacturers are investing in specialized surface treatments to meet quality and performance standards.
  • Growth in Consumer Electronics
    The proliferation of smartphones, laptops, wearables, and other electronic devices has driven demand for miniaturized and precision components with high conductivity and corrosion resistance. Metal finishing processes like gold plating, tin plating, and nickel plating are used to improve the performance and longevity of connectors, PCBs, and microchips.
  • Infrastructure and Construction Projects
    Increasing infrastructure development and urbanization, particularly in developing economies, are creating opportunities for metal finishing in construction materials, hardware, and structural components. Galvanizing and powder coating techniques are commonly used to protect metal structures from corrosion and enhance their aesthetic value.
  • Aerospace and Defense Sector Requirements
    Aircraft and defense equipment require high-performance coatings to endure harsh environments, high altitudes, and rapid temperature fluctuations. Aerospace components often undergo anodizing, cadmium plating, and hard chrome plating to meet strict industry regulations and safety standards.
  • Rising Focus on Corrosion Resistance and Aesthetics
    With consumer preferences evolving and quality expectations rising, manufacturers are increasingly focusing on achieving superior surface finishes that provide both functionality and visual appeal. This trend is particularly evident in the furniture, appliance, and decorative hardware industries.

Market Restraints

Despite its wide application, the metal plating and finishing market faces several challenges:

  • Stringent Environmental Regulations: Traditional plating methods often involve toxic chemicals such as hexavalent chromium and cyanides. Regulatory agencies such as the EPA and REACH have imposed strict guidelines on the use, disposal, and treatment of hazardous substances, pushing manufacturers to adopt environmentally compliant technologies.
  • High Initial Investment and Maintenance Costs: Advanced metal finishing systems, especially those incorporating automation and waste treatment, can be capital intensive. Small and medium-sized enterprises may face financial constraints in upgrading existing facilities.
  • Volatility in Raw Material Prices: Prices of key raw materials such as nickel, zinc, and copper are subject to market fluctuations, impacting the overall cost of plating and finishing operations.

Technological Advancements

The industry is witnessing rapid technological innovation to meet changing customer demands and regulatory compliance. Some notable developments include:

  • Nanotechnology-Based Coatings: Nanocoatings offer improved performance characteristics such as superior hardness, anti-corrosion, anti-fouling, and self-cleaning properties. These coatings are gaining traction in medical devices, electronics, and marine applications.
  • Automation and Robotics in Plating Lines: Automation increases production efficiency, consistency, and safety while reducing labor costs. Smart sensors, AI integration, and robotic arms are increasingly being deployed in plating facilities to monitor processes in real time.
  • Environmentally Friendly Alternatives: The shift toward green chemistry has led to the development of water-based coatings, bio-based solvents, and trivalent chromium plating systems, which significantly reduce toxic waste generation.
